Advice: Critical Thinking

To navigate the world of media critically, it’s crucial for people to engage in active, rather than passive, consumption. This means questioning the content, understanding its purpose, and reflecting on its effects. Making this a habit can guard against subliminal influences that may shape beliefs unconsciously.

  • 🛡️ Tips for Critical Media Consumption:
    1. Always ask what the purpose of the content is.
    2. Consider who benefits from the content.
    3. Look for the source and its potential biases.

Research conflicting viewpoints.

By enhancing your awareness and promoting a questioning mindset, you protect your own thoughts and make independent judgments based on a broader understanding of the media’s role and influence.
